I carved this fish out of two 13 x 9's that I had stacked. This was the first time that I had carved a cake and it was a very scary task! I covered the cake in fondant and hand painted the coloration on. The lady requested that the "bait" on the hook be a wedding ring. I thought it turned out cute.

I decorated this cake with buttercream and sculpted a rice crispie treat into a diamond that I covered in fondant and brushed with a pearl dust. I then did some fondant accents on the tiffany colored box. I had so much fun making this one. I had to put a skewer in the diamond so it wouldn't fall over. (it was heavy!)
